Re: Muster roll of Co. K, 5th Reg. Vol. Inf.

Always read the service file to determine that wartime documents match the family story. In this case it does not.

Records for John Wesley Gilbert show that he enrolled in Co. "I", 5th Georgia Regt., May 11, 1861, Macon GA. After one year's service he became a member of Co. "A", 2nd Georgia Sharpshooter Battn. Gilbert was wounded at Murfreesboro TN, Dec. 31, 1862, and absent due to wounds for some time. The roll for Aug. 31, 1864, last on file, shows him present, serving as a nurse at the division field hospital. A pension application in his name appears to have been filed in 1915.
